// Plugin client bootstrap for the Ferroline hermetic build migration.
// During the transition, plugins must resolve toolchains through the
// Crucible artifact proxy instead of the host machine. Anything fetched
// outside the proxy will break reproducibility checks and fail the
// hermeticity gate. Network access inside the sandbox is limited to the
// proxy endpoint, so configure your client accordingly before first use.
// The proxy authenticates plugin clients via the internal Crucible API,
// using the key that follows.

gateway credential: zpat4_qSKI

# Fan-out settings for Stormcrier, the weather-alert dispatcher.
# Alerts arrive from the ingest tier, are deduplicated by region hash,
# then fanned out to subscriber shards. If fan-out latency exceeds 30s,
# check the shard lag table before restarting anything — a restart
# mid-fan-out can double-send alerts to the Northvale region.
# Batch size and retry backoff are tuned; change only with a ticket.
# The dispatcher tracks delivery state in the alerts database,
# which it reaches via the connection string below.

primary connection of yagep-kahip = redis://giliel_svc:zYiKsLL2PLpfPL@db-348f.xolmarsys.corp:5432/fenwyn

Support team, please read carefully. The Marrowline realtime gateways were intended to run with permessage-deflate enabled only for payloads above a size threshold, balancing bandwidth savings against CPU and memory amplification. An ad-hoc change on two nodes in the Dunsmoor pool enabled unconditional compression, so customers there may report higher latency under bursty traffic while other pools look fine. When triaging, compare the node you are on against the canonical values, which are the following.

config for kafof-bawef:
holath:
  log_level: debug
  metrics_host: metrics.holath.qorvelsys.internal
  pin: 2191
  pool_size: 32